Playing songs and recording your performances
You can record your own performance on the V-Piano.
1.
In the song screen, choose song number 000 (song name: New Song).

2.
If you want the metronome to sound while you’re recording, turn Function on, and press the [F4 (OPTION)]
button.
The option menu will appear.

In the option menu, use the [F3 (
)] button or the [F4 (
)] button to select a metronome parameter.
Use the [VALUE] dial to change the setting of the selected parameter.
3.
When you’ve finished making metronome settings, press the [EXIT] button to return to the song screen.
4.
In the song screen, turn Function on, press the [F1 (TEMPO)] button, and turn the [VALUE] dial to adjust the
metronome tempo.

Parameter Description
Metronome Switch
Turns the metronome on/off.
Metronome Volume Adjusts the metronome volume.
Beat Specifies the time signature.
